Medasia Marine delivers UAE’s first electric XShore1 boat, pioneering sustainable marine transport and advancing eco-friendly boating in the Middle East.
Medasia Marine is pleased to announce the successful delivery and registration of the region’s first 100% electric X Shore 1 boat to a customer in Dubai.
This milestone marks a significant advancement in the UAE’s journey towards sustainability and modern marine technology.
At its core, the X Shore 1, developed by Swedish electric boat pioneer X Shore, represents a revolutionary shift in the maritime industry. This eco-friendly vessel features a state-of-the-art electric motor and is constructed using sustainable materials, offering a silent, emission-free boating experience without compromising on
performance or luxury. Widely recognized as the “Tesla of electric boats,” X Shore has garnered multiple awards and operates one of the most advanced high-tech factories in Sweden.
Additionally, the X Shore 1 boasts an impressive range of up to 50 nautical miles and can reach speeds of up to 30 knots, making it a powerful yet sustainable choice for marine enthusiasts. With its sleek design and commitment to reducing environmental impact, the X Shore 1 sets a new benchmark for sustainable boating in the Middle East. Its arrival in Dubai reflects the growing global trend toward electric and sustainable marine solutions, with the UAE positioning itself as a regional leader in this innovative space.

Medasia Marine, headquartered in Abu Dhabi with branches in Malta and the United Kingdom, has long been recognized for its expertise in yacht sales, management, and marine consultancy. The company provides a comprehensive range of services,
including design and construction, refit projects, class-approved surveys, and yacht chartering. With plans to expand its dealership network to Jeddah, Oman, and other
prime locations across the GCC and Europe, Medasia Marine is poised to lead the future of sustainable marine solutions.
